Kenya: Akiira Geothermal adopts a stakeholder engagement plan after previous claims over failure to consult with local communities

The SEP aims to ensure a proactive, well-coordinated and structured approach to community and stakeholder engagement within the project area. It is a tool used to help recognize the stakeholders’ human rights by allowing them to express their views on the project and how it will impact their lives. The Project developer believes that engaging the people as project partners helps to build community understanding and increase collaboration and support for current and future activities.
